Playa Tamarindo, located on the Pacific Coast in the Guanacaste province, is one of the most-visited beach towns for countless reasons so if your planing on staying for a long period you may want to know about the Tamarindo grocery stores.

There are at least five small supermarkets here in Tamarindo that I know of: Super 2001, Las Palmas, Las Palmeras, Super Langosta, Super Compro and the Tamarindo Automercado. All of them have similar prices, so getting snacks, drinks or bathroom products is not a problem. The prices are rather higher than in the USA, except for some local fresh fruits and veggies. I would definitely recommend visiting Automercado. It is a big supermarket about a kilometer away from Tamarindo and it has almost everything you need including the familiar western foods. It won’t be cheaper than buying in local supermarkets but there you will have a better choice of products.

It carries Costa Rican brands, such as Monteverde cheese, Dos Pinos dairy and produce and imported products familiar to Canadian and American visitors and other nationalities including Kraft, General Mills, Nabisco, etc.

The supermarket is comparable to modern supermarkets in the USA and Canada, as you should be able to see in this photo.
